Singlet aided infinite resource reduction in the comparison of distant fields
arXiv:quant-ph/0005020 · doi:10.1103/PhysRevA.63.032313
Abstract
We present a task which can be faithfully solved with finite resources only when aided by particles prepared in a particular entangled state: the singlet state. The task consists of identifying the mutual parallelity or orthogonality of weak distant magnetic fields whose absolute directions are completely unknown.
